Pop Smoke Killer Sentenced for Fentanyl in Juvenile Hall
By The BriefBrief · Sources (1)
Filed: Aug 19, 2026 at 8:00 PM ET
Summary: Deijae Devon Jester gets four years in County Jail for distributing fentanyl while serving time in LA County juvenile detention.
WHO: Deijae Devon Jester; Los Angeles County District Attorney Nathan J. Hochman
WHAT: Jester was sentenced to four years in County Jail for fentanyl possession for sale and bringing contraband into a juvenile hall; his mother faced related charges.
WHEN: Aug 14, 2026 at 7:18 PM ET
WHERE: San Fernando Courthouse, San Fernando, Los Angeles County, California
WHY: Jester chose to traffic fentanyl from inside a juvenile detention facility after being given a chance at rehabilitation.
